The quantities xxx and yyy are proportional. xxx yyy 141414 1.41.41, point, 4 161616 1.61.61, point, 6 212121 2.12.12, point, 1

Find the constant of proportionality (r)(r)left parenthesis, r, right parenthesis in the equation y=rxy=rxy, equals, r, x. r =

Answer:

8/7

Step-by-step explanation:

Given

x = 1.4 when y = 1.6

Required

Determine the constant of proportionality

The relationship between y and x is

y = kx

Where k represents the proportionality constant

Make k the subject

k = y/x..

Substitute values for x and y

k = 1.6/1.4

Multiply numerator and denominator by 10

k = 16/14

k = 8/7

Hence, the proportionality constant is 8/7

There are 20 gallons of 20% butterbeer solution.
Assume there are x gallons of 80% solution.

So total amount of the solution will be (x+20) gallons
The final solution is 50%.

So, we can set up the equation as:

0.2(20)+0.8(x)=0.5(x+20) \\ \\ 4+0.8x=0.5x+10 \\ \\ 0.8x-0.5x=10-4 \\ \\ 0.3x=6 x=20.

Thus, there will be 20 gallons of 80% butterbeer solution that is needed to be mixed with 20 gallons of 20% butterbeer solution.

Pecans that cost $28.50 per kilogram were mixed with almonds that cost $22.25 per kilogram. How many kilograms of each were used
atroni [7]

Answer:

The pecans used in the mixture =  8 kg

The almonds used in the mixture  =  17 kg

Step-by-step explanation:

The cost of per kg of pecans  = $28.50

The cost of per kg of almonds = $22.25

Now, total weight of mixture  = 25 kg

Let us assume the weight of pecans in the mixture   =   m kg

So, the amount of almonds in the mixture  = Total weight - Weight of Pecans

= (25 - m) kg

Now, cost of m kg pecans  = m x ( cost of 1 kg pecans) = m x ( $ 28.50)

                                              =  28.50 m

cost of (25- m) kg almonds  = (25 -m)  x ( cost of 1 kg almonds)

                                                = (25 - m) x ( $ 22.25)

                                                =  556.25  - 22.25 m

Total cost  of 25 kg of mixture  = 25 x ( $24.25) =  $606.25

Now, Total Cost of (almonds  + Pecans)  = Total cost of mixture

⇒28.50 m + 556.25  - 22.25 m  = $606.25

or,6.25 m =  50

or, m = 50/6.25 =  8

Hence, the pecans used in the mixture = m = 8 kg

And the  almonds used in the mixture  = (25 - m) = 25 - 8 = 17 kg
